Compliance record
Formal violations the EPA has on file for this supplier. A health-based violation means a contaminant limit or a required treatment was breached; the rest are monitoring or reporting failures — still violations, but not a measured health risk.
| Violation | Type | Status | Period |
|---|---|---|---|
| MCL | Health-based | Resolved | 1996-07-01 → 1996-07-31 |
| MCL | Health-based | Resolved | 1996-07-01 → 1996-07-31 |
| MCL | Health-based | Resolved | 1996-07-01 → 1996-07-31 |
| MCL | Health-based | Resolved | 1996-07-01 → 1996-07-31 |
| MR | Monitoring | Resolved | 2025-07-01 |
| MR | Monitoring | Resolved | 2025-01-01 |
| Other | Monitoring | Resolved | 2023-07-01 |
| MR | Monitoring | Resolved | 2023-07-01 |
| MR | Monitoring | Resolved | 2017-08-01 → 2017-08-31 |
| MR | Monitoring | Resolved | 2017-08-01 → 2017-08-31 |
Other contaminants detected
| Contaminant | Level vs EPA limit | Detection rate | Source | Period |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| TTHM | 55.6 µg/L 70% of the EPA limit 80 µg/L | 128/128 | SYR4 | 2012–2019 |
| Total Haloacetic Acids (HAA5) | 56.9 µg/L 95% of the EPA limit 60 µg/L | 128/128 | SYR4 | 2012–2019 |
| Lead | 256 µg/L 1707% of the EPA limit, in the worst sample — 15 µg/L | 98/303 | SYR4 | 2012–2018 |
| Copper | 97 µg/L 7.5% of the EPA limit 1300 µg/L | 48/303 | SYR4 | 2012–2018 |
| Lead | 0.0017 mg/L 12% of the EPA limit 0.0150 mg/L | 26/26 | LCR | 2025 |
| Nitrate | 700 µg/L 7% of the EPA limit 10000 µg/L | 10/16 | SYR4 | 2012–2019 |
| Nitrate-Nitrite | 700 µg/L 7% of the EPA limit 10000 µg/L | 5/8 | SYR4 | 2012–2019 |
| Barium | 4.35 µg/L 0.2% of the EPA limit 2000 µg/L | 2/8 | SYR4 | 2012–2019 |
| Nitrite | 58.1 µg/L 5.8% of the EPA limit 1000 µg/L | 2/8 | SYR4 | 2012–2019 |
| Gross Alpha, Excl. Radon And U | 4.5 pCi/L 30% of the EPA limit 15 pCi/L | 1/2 | SYR4 | 2012–2017 |
92 contaminants tested, none detected

How many people does Clackamas River Water serve?
Clackamas River Water reports serving 29,918 people in Oregon, per its EPA record.
Has Clackamas River Water had any water quality violations?
The EPA has 81 violations on file for Clackamas River Water, of which 4 are health-based (a contaminant limit or required treatment was breached) and 0 remain open. The rest are monitoring or reporting failures.
